The video discusses the S&P 500 market outlook, predicting a potential bottom around 3000 to 3300 due to recent bearish trends. It highlights the bear market rally's role and suggests a nearing end to the bear market. The discussion shifts to bonds, noting a bullish stance since summer and contrasting current systemic risks with those of 2008. The video also addresses the Federal Reserve's limited accommodative capacity due to inflation, a new challenge for the investment community. The potential slower response in labor cycles and its impact on S&P 500 price levels is also considered.
